Gov Otu Approves 14 Days Christmas Holiday For Civil Servants
Cross River State Governor, Bassey Otu, has approved a 14-day Christmas holiday for all civil servants in the state effective from December 20.
The Chief Press Secretary, to the governor, Mr Emmanuel Ogbeche, revealed this in a statement made available to newsmen in Calabar on Wednesday.
The statement, however, said those on essential services were exempted from this holiday.
In the statement titled “Extended Holiday for Civil Servants”, Otu praised the workers for their commitment and hard work.
He urged the workers to use the opportunity to spend quality time with their families and also be actively involved in the annual Calabar carnival.
The governor restated the commitment of his administration to provide quality and conducive environment for all citizens and residents of the state while wishing them a Merry Christmas and a Prosperous New Year.
The workers are expected back at their duty posts on Jan. 3, 2024.
